Форум программистов, компьютерный форум CyberForum.ru
Наши страницы

В каждом идентификаторе с нечетным порядковым номером удвоить последнюю букву - C++

Войти
Регистрация
Восстановить пароль
Другие темы раздела
C++ Извлечение данных из программы http://www.cyberforum.ru/cpp-beginners/thread344951.html
в игре Counter Strike 1.6 на deathrun сервере в чате бывают задания где надо произвести арифметические операции с 5 числами и в том же чате надо написать ответ плз напишите функции которые будут...
C++ Перегрузка функций Задача: создать объект формирующий HTML теги. Теги бывают двух типов - полные <p параметры_тега>Текст абзаца</p> и короткие <input параметры_тега />. Хочу за счет создания разных подклассов тегов... http://www.cyberforum.ru/cpp-beginners/thread344940.html
Степень комплексного числа в C++ C++
Не могу сообразить- как написать кусок программы для возведения комплексного числа в целую степень. Нашел в инете прогу, пробую запускать- пишет разнообразные ошибки- ругается вот на этот кусок:...
C++ Сортировка точек в порядке обхода
Дано n точек. В массиве a. Надо отсортировать точки в порядке обхода по или против часовой стрелки. Нужна помощь.
C++ функция типа bool http://www.cyberforum.ru/cpp-beginners/thread344882.html
Привет! Подскажите пожалуйста как написать функцию типа bool. Есть вектор целых чисел, в котором надо найти заданное число. Если оно есть функция возвращает true, если такова числа в векторе нет -...
C++ Сохранение(загрузка) свойств элементов формы в файл Здравствуйте! Необходимо реализовать взможность сохрнения/загрузки свойств элементов ComboBox (itemindex), Label(caption) и Edit(text) в/из одного файла(разрешение не имеет значения). з.ы. в Edit... подробнее

Показать сообщение отдельно
lexflax
10 / 10 / 1
Регистрация: 03.04.2011
Сообщений: 627

В каждом идентификаторе с нечетным порядковым номером удвоить последнюю букву - C++

24.08.2011, 15:08. Просмотров 461. Ответов 4
Метки (Все метки)

Задана последовательность идентификаторов, разделенных сериями пробелов. Последовательность задана строкой символов (string) заканчивается символом ‘*’. В каждом идентификаторе с нечетным порядковым номером удвоить последнюю букву.( решение задания этого есть все работает, мне интересен пример увидеть чтоб их текстового файла выводил всю инфорцацию на экран , причем чтоб по строчно , допустим если срок пять , то каждое нажатие ентр выводило по одной строке, кто может напишите плиз листинг такой проги , сам не смогу, но очень хочется посмотреть и разобраться по листингку что за что отвечает) а пример ниже по первому заданию может его можно изменить чтоб было то что мне нужно...
C++
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
25
26
27
28
29
30
31
32
33
34
#include <vcl.h>
#pragma hdrstop
#pragma argsused
# include <iostream>              // класс для работы с вводом-выводом
# include <fstream>
#include <conio.h>        // класс для работы с файлом
# include <string>
//---------------------------------------------------------------------------
 
void main()
{
    using namespace std;
    string st,stt;
    cout << "enter name files:" <<endl;
    char name[10];
    cin >> name;
    ifstream inf(name);
    getline(inf,st);
    int i = 0, f = 1;
    for(i=0; i < st.length(); i++)
        if((st[i] == ' ' || st[i] == '*') && st[i-1] != ' '){
         if(f == 1){
         f = 0;
         stt = stt + st[i-1] + " ";
         }else {
          f = 1;
          stt +=" ";
         }
        }else{
            stt +=st[i];
        }
    cout << stt;
    getch ();
}
 Комментарий модератора 
Используйте теги форматирования кода!
0
Надоела реклама? Зарегистрируйтесь и она исчезнет полностью.
 
КиберФорум - форум программистов, компьютерный форум, программирование
Powered by vBulletin® Version 3.8.9
Copyright ©2000 - 2017, vBulletin Solutions, Inc.
Рейтинг@Mail.ru